



Unsettled Week for the West; Fire Weather Concerns for Plains
An unsettled week is likely for the Western U.S. as a big storm system off the West Coast shifts into the Southwest and Four Corners region. Expect cooler temperatures, locally heavy rain showers for California coastal areas and widespread heavy mountain snow with lowering snow levels. Meanwhile, several days of critical fire weather concerns are expected for the southern High Plains this week. Read More >
